 /// <summary>Split this 128-bit UUID into two 64-bit numbers</summary>
 /// <param name="high">Receives the first 8 bytes (in network order) of this UUID</param>
 /// <param name="low">Receives the last 8 bytes (in network order) of this UUID</param>
 public void Split(out ulong high, out ulong low)
 {
     unsafe
     {
         byte *buffer = stackalloc byte[16];
         WriteUnsafe(m_packed, buffer);
         high = Uuid64.ReadUnsafe(buffer);
         low  = Uuid64.ReadUnsafe(buffer + 8);
     }
 }

 /// <summary>Split this 128-bit UUID into two 64-bit numbers</summary>
 /// <param name="high">Receives the first 8 bytes (in network order) of this UUID</param>
 /// <param name="mid">Receives the middle 4 bytes (in network order) of this UUID</param>
 /// <param name="low">Receives the last 4 bytes (in network order) of this UUID</param>
 public void Split(out ulong high, out uint mid, out uint low)
 {
     unsafe
     {
         byte *buffer = stackalloc byte[16];
         WriteUnsafe(m_packed, buffer);
         high = Uuid64.ReadUnsafe(buffer);
         var id = Uuid64.ReadUnsafe(buffer + 8);
         mid = (uint)(id >> 32);
         low = (uint)id;
     }
 }
